在这里,我将为您提供一个适合推广的以及相关

                      发布时间:2025-03-24 13:56:07
                      ## 引言 比特币作为一种去中心化的数字货币,其安全性和匿名性备受关注。在使用比特币之前,用户需要创建比特币钱包并生成比特币地址。本文将详细探讨如何计算比特币钱包地址,包括地址的产生过程、相关技术,以及安全性的重要性。 ## 什么是比特币钱包地址? 比特币钱包地址是用户接收和发送比特币的唯一标识符。它通常由一串字母和数字组成,并以1、3或bc1开头。用户可以将这个地址分享给其他人,以便他们能够将比特币发送到该地址。比特币地址本质上是公钥的一个压缩形式,是确保交易安全的重要部分。 ## 比特币钱包地址的计算过程 计算比特币钱包地址的过程涉及多个步骤,包括密钥生成、地址编码和哈希运算等。以下是生成比特币钱包地址的具体步骤: ### 1. 生成私钥 私钥是比特币钱包的核心,它是一个随机生成的256位二进制数。私钥的安全性至关重要,因为任何拥有私钥的人都可以控制与之关联的比特币。生成私钥的方法有很多种,通常使用密码学随机数生成器来确保其不可预测性。 ### 2. 从私钥生成公钥 私钥通过椭圆曲线乘法算法(Elliptic Curve Cryptography, ECC)生成对应的公钥。此过程涉及到以下几个步骤: - 从私钥计算曲线上的点。 - 将这个点的x和y坐标压缩,生成公钥。 ### 3. 应用SHA-256哈希算法 公钥生成后,首先应用SHA-256算法进行哈希处理。SHA-256是一种加密哈希函数,可以将输入(公钥)转换为一个固定长度的256位输出。 ### 4. 应用RIPEMD-160哈希算法 对SHA-256的输出结果再进行RIPEMD-160哈希运算,这将输出一个160位的哈希值。这个哈希值就是比特币地址的核心部分,称为公钥哈希(Public Key Hash)。 ### 5. 添加网络标识符 比特币网络使用不同的前缀来区分不同类型的地址。例如,常规比特币地址以“1”开头的(P2PKH)会被标记,而以“3”开头的(P2SH)地址会标记为多重签名地址。在这个段落中,我们在公钥哈希前添加一个字节,指明地址类型。 ### 6. 计算校验和 为了防止错误产生,地址计算的最后一步是为公钥哈希增加校验和。我们对公钥哈希的结果再经过SHA-256和RIPEMD-160两次哈希运算,得到256位的哈希结果,然后提取前四个字节作为校验和。 ### 7. 编码为Base58Check格式 最后,我们将包含网络标识符、公钥哈希和校验和的字节序列转换为Base58Check字符串。这种编码格式被广泛使用,因为它避免了容易混淆的字符(如0与O,I与l)。 ## 区块链和比特币地址的关系 区块链技术是比特币的基础,其它数字货币都基于这一原理。比特币地址不可逆,即给定一个地址无法唯一确定相应的私钥。比特币地址通过区块链确保了交易的不可篡改性和公开性。 在区块链网络中,每当用户使用比特币地址进行交易时,这笔交易会被打包到一个区块中,并在网络上进行验证。比特币的透明性确保任何人都可以查看与某个地址相关的所有交易记录。但用户的个人信息却是保密的,从而提升了隐私保护。 ## 常见问题解析 ###

                      如何安全地管理比特币私钥?

                      比特币私钥是锁定您比特币资产的关键,因此其安全性至关重要。以下是一些管理私钥的最佳实践: 1. **使用硬件钱包**: 硬件钱包是存储私钥的最佳选择。它们是一种专用设备,能够离线保存您的私钥,避免网络攻击。 2. **使用助记词**: 在生成比特币钱包时,大多数钱包都会提供12个到24个助记词。这些助记词可以用来恢复钱包,因此一定要妥善保管。 3. **定期备份**: 定期备份您的钱包,以便在设备丢失时恢复资产。要备份私钥和钱包文件,并将它们保存在安全的地方。 4. **避免在线存储**: 尽量避免在任何在线服务中存储私钥,尤其是那些不可信的服务。在线钱包容易成为黑客攻击的目标。 5. **加强密码保护**: 如果使用的是软件钱包,确保使用强密码,并启用双因素身份验证,以增强安全性。 随着比特币的普及,黑客攻击案例屡见不鲜。因此,理解如何安全有效地管理私钥是每个比特币用户的重要责任。 ###

                      比特币地址是否可以更改?

                      比特币地址的生成是基于公钥和私钥的,因此一旦生成,它是固定的。不过,用户可以选择生成新的比特币地址并将比特币转移到新地址中。以下是更改比特币地址的一些情况: 1. **创建新的钱包**: 如果您希望更改比特币地址,可以创建一个新的钱包。新钱包会生成新的私钥和公钥,从而提供了一个新的比特币地址。 2. **隐私保护**: 用户可能会选择定期使用新地址进行交易,以提升隐私保护。每次接受比特币时,建议生成新的地址,这样即可不容易追踪交易。 3. **使用分层确定性钱包**: 许多现代钱包支持分层确定性(HD)钱包,它们允许用户在同一钱包中生成无数个地址,这些地址均使用相同的助记词恢复。 4. **网络转移**: 如果需要从一种比特币网络转移到另一种网络,例如从比特币到比特币现金,您可能需要创建新的地址以完成转移。 虽然比特币地址无法直接更改,但通过上述方法,您可以轻松获得新的地址并持续管理您的比特币资产。 ###

                      什么是多重签名地址,如何生成?

                      多重签名地址是比特币区块链的一种增强安全性的方法,特别适用于共同管理的资产。多重签名(Multisig)允许多个密钥共同控制一个比特币地址,以提高安全性。 1. **定义需要的密钥数**: 通常是“m-of-n”模型,例如2-of-3需要2个私钥来进行交易。选择合适的m和n以及参与者,以适应特定场景。 2. **生成公钥**: 每个参与者需要生成自己的私钥和公钥。然后,将参与者的公钥在一起,用于创建多重签名地址。 3. **使用P2SH(Pay-to-Script-Hash)地址**: 多重签名地址通常使用P2SH格式。它允许创建自定义脚本,而不是直接将比特币发送至公钥。这种地址以“3”开头。 4. **创建脚本**: 脚本将所有参与者的公钥结合在一起,并规定哪些密钥(即定义的条件)需要共同签署以完成交易。 5. **获取多重签名地址**: 通过对自定义脚本计算哈希值,并生成P2SH地址,用户就可以得到一个新的多重签名地址。 多重签名技术为比特币提供了额外的安全层次,通过确保交易必须经过多个参与者的共识来减少资产丢失的风险。 ###

                      如何处理比特币地址的错误?

                      在进行比特币交易时,地址错误的问题时有发生。例如,用户可能会错误输入地址、发送到不支持的地址类型等。以下是在出现这些错误时的一些处理方法: 1. **确认地址有效性**: 在发送比特币之前,应该仔细检查地址的有效性。大多数钱包都会提供自动验证功能,以确保地址格式正确。 2. **使用小额测试**: 初次交易时,可以先发送小额比特币测试确认,确保交易成功再进行大额转账。 3. **联系钱包客服**: 如果地址错误导致比特币发送失败,可以联系钱包提供商的客服请求帮助。虽然大多数情况下无法恢复,但他们会尝试提供帮助。 4. **学习如何避免错误**: 理解比特币地址的结构,避免混淆相似字符,养成在复制粘贴前检查地址的习惯,将有助于减少错误的发生。 5. **使用链上服务**: 一些服务允许用户在错误的地址上尝试找回比特币,但这需谨慎使用,应选择可信赖的平台。 通过以上解决方法,用户可以在发生比特币地址错误时有效应对,确保交易的完整性和安全性。 ## 结论 比特币钱包地址的计算涉及多个步骤,包括私钥生成、公钥生成、哈希运算等。安全管理私钥和使用多重签名是保护比特币资产的有效方法。面对比特币交易中的错误,了解有效的处理方法至关重要。 本文不仅详细分析了如何计算比特币钱包地址,并回答了一系列相关问题,为读者提供了全面的知识基础。这些知识为比特币的使用和管理提供了良好的指导,助力用户在未来的数字货币世界中保持安全和高效。
                      分享 :
                          author

                          tpwallet

                          T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                      相关新闻

                                      中国数字货币怎样下载使
                                      2024-03-14
                                      中国数字货币怎样下载使

                                      中国数字货币有哪些种类? 中国数字货币指的是由中国政府发行的法定数字货币。目前,中国的数字货币有两个主要...

                                      解决以太坊钱包内存不足
                                      2024-10-15
                                      解决以太坊钱包内存不足

                                      引言 随着以太坊区块链的迅速发展和不断扩大的用户基础,越来越多的人开始选择以太坊钱包来管理他们的加密资产...

                                      : K豆钱包与USDT:哪种数字
                                      2025-03-27
                                      : K豆钱包与USDT:哪种数字

                                      引言 在加密货币投资的世界中,安全性是每个投资者必须考虑的重要因素。K豆钱包和USDT是众多数字货币和钱包中的...

                                      数字货币没信号怎么登录
                                      2023-12-07
                                      数字货币没信号怎么登录

                                      为什么数字货币没有信号? 数字货币没有信号的原因可能有很多。一种可能性是网络连接的问题,包括网络信号弱或不...